Pricing for the median home in Chaska increased during February 2021

The median sale price of a home sold in February 2021 in Chaska rose by $28,400 while total sales decreased by 52.2%, according to BlockShopper.com.

In February 2021, there were 11 homes sold, with a median sale price of $300,000 - a 10.5% increase over the $271,600 median sale price for the same period of the previous year. There were 23 homes sold in Chaska in February 2020.

The median sales tax in Chaska for the most recent year with available data, 2019, was $3,272, approximately 1.1% of the median home sale price for February 2021.
